The sixth book in Jill Shalvis’s Heartbreaker Bay series, Hot Winter Nights is the story of security specialist Lucas Knight and Hunt Investigations office manager, Molly Malone. Two people who have lost so much yet somehow, despite the pain and disappointment, find the strength to not only carry on but also take jobs that allows them to help others.
Fun, witty banter. Hot, sexy romance. Forbidden love. A dangerous case. All the things I love and want in a good romance story, and exactly what I’ve come to love about the Heartbreaker Bay series. On the surface, these are feel good romances that provide escape from the daily grind, but they also offer a deep look into the emotional psyche of some truly spectacular hero and heroines.
Molly is a strong and confident woman with a painful past and she wants nothing more than to become a field operative like Lucas and her brother, Joe. Yet the powers that be continue to hold her at arm’s length out of fear she’ll get hurt. Molly knows she has to prove herself though, and as such, she enlists Lucas’s help in an off-the-books “Bad Santa” case. It’s as the case ramps up that her relationship with Lucas takes a turn from teasing to more, a fact that Lucas knows her brother and the rest of the team will hate.
As Lucas and Molly navigate the case set before them, they also come to terms with who they are and what they want-and what they want most might just be each other.
With incredible characters and emotionally gripping scenes, Hot Winter Nights is a must-read. It’s solid, beautiful, and will give you plenty of delightfully warm and fuzzy romance feels. I highly recommend it!
About HOT WINTER NIGHTS
Author: Jill Shalvis
Series: Heartbreaker Bay #6
Imprint: Avon Books
Genre: Romance | Contemporary
Publication: Sept. 25, 2018
Who needs mistletoe?
Most people wouldn’t think of a bad Santa case as the perfect Christmas gift. Then again, Molly Malone, office manager at Hunt Investigations, isn’t most people, and she could really use a distraction from the fantasies she’s been having since spending the night with her very secret crush, Lucas Knight. Nothing happened, not that Lucas knows that — but Molly just wants to enjoy being a little naughty for once…
Whiskey and pain meds for almost-healed bullet wounds don’t mix. Lucas needs to remember that next time he’s shot on the job, which may be sooner rather than later if Molly’s brother, Joe, finds out about them. Lucas can’t believe he’s drawing a blank on his (supposedly) passionate tryst with Molly, who’s the hottest, smartest, strongest woman he’s ever known. Strong enough to kick his butt if she discovers he’s been assigned to babysit her on her first case. And hot enough to melt his cold heart this Christmas.
